Output 40ae57a63aaf59ea704bb8fd80420c25fa9413863878551aaad237dca0a5fbe7:5

value
2122220
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69d151600c1cea60fe35a82f8642cc9580accbbb OP_EQUAL
address
3BLXdM4P4ZbZNRatK5ZGSbUSiUcnJWtyfV
transaction
40ae57a63aaf59ea704bb8fd80420c25fa9413863878551aaad237dca0a5fbe7
spent
true